#d3bccf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d3bccf is composed of 82.7% red, 73.7%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.9% magenta, 1.9%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 310.4 degrees, a saturation of 20.7% and a lightness of 78.2%. #d3bccf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a7799f.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#d3bccf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040304 is the darkest color, while #faf7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d3bccf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cac5c9 is the less saturated color, while #fe91eb is the most saturated one.
